Overview
Woodridge is a vibrant suburb in Logan, just north of Logan Central and 20 km south‑east of Brisbane. The 2021 census recorded 12,982 residents, creating a youthful, multicultural community. Green spaces such as Acacia Forest Park, Booran Park and Karawatha Forest Park provide recreation, while the Woodridge Adventure Park adds a popular skate bowl and the local Scout Group offers community activities.
Woodridge enjoys strong rail links, with Woodridge station in the adjacent Logan Central business district and Trinder Park station both on the Queensland Rail City network (TransLink Zone 2) offering regular services to Brisbane and Beenleigh. Local primary schools include Woodridge North State School, Harris Fields State School and St Paul’s Catholic School, while secondary students travel to nearby Woodridge State High School in Logan Central. Emergency services are represented by a fire station, ambulance station and an SES facility.
